Alibaba's Qwen-Robot series brings AI to embodied robots with three specialized models
Three new models give robots dexterous hands, navigation skills, and world understanding.
Alibaba Group has unveiled the Qwen-Robot series, its first comprehensive embodied intelligence model lineup designed to equip robots with advanced cognitive and physical capabilities. The series comprises three distinct models: Qwen-RobotManip for dexterous manipulation, enabling precise control of robotic arms and grippers for tasks like assembly and object handling; Qwen-RobotNav for efficient navigation, allowing autonomous movement through complex environments using spatial reasoning; and Qwen-RobotWorld for world modeling, giving robots a cognitive understanding of surroundings through perception and memory. Each model leverages Alibaba's Qwen large language model architecture, integrating natural language understanding with sensorimotor skills. This marks a significant step in embodied AI, where AI systems can perceive, reason, and act in the physical world. The models are designed to work independently for specific tasks or collaboratively, with Qwen-RobotManip handling object interaction, Qwen-RobotNav managing movement, and Qwen-RobotWorld providing contextual awareness.
The collaborative architecture allows robots to tackle complex multi-step tasks by combining manipulation, navigation, and world modeling capabilities. For example, a robot could use Qwen-RobotWorld to understand a warehouse layout, Qwen-RobotNav to navigate to a shelf, and Qwen-RobotManip to pick and place items. This modular approach offers flexibility for developers and researchers to deploy robots in real-world scenarios such as manufacturing, logistics, and service applications.
